|  | /* | 
|  | * this is what the terminal answers to a ESC-Z or csi0c query. | 
|  | */ | 
|  | #define VT100ID "\033[?1;2c" | 
|  | #define VT102ID "\033[?6c" | 
|  |  | 
|  | struct consw { | 
|  | struct module *owner; | 
|  | const char *(*con_startup)(void); | 
|  | void	(*con_init)(struct vc_data *, int); | 
|  | void	(*con_deinit)(struct vc_data *); | 
|  | void	(*con_clear)(struct vc_data *, int, int, int, int); | 
|  | void	(*con_putc)(struct vc_data *, int, int, int); | 
|  | void	(*con_putcs)(struct vc_data *, const unsigned short *, int, int, int); | 
|  | void	(*con_cursor)(struct vc_data *, int); | 
|  | int	(*con_scroll)(struct vc_data *, int, int, int, int); | 
|  | void	(*con_bmove)(struct vc_data *, int, int, int, int, int, int); | 
|  | int	(*con_switch)(struct vc_data *); | 
|  | int	(*con_blank)(struct vc_data *, int, int); | 
|  | int	(*con_font_set)(struct vc_data *, struct console_font *, unsigned); | 
|  | int	(*con_font_get)(struct vc_data *, struct console_font *); | 
|  | int	(*con_font_default)(struct vc_data *, struct console_font *, char *); | 
|  | int	(*con_font_copy)(struct vc_data *, int); | 
|  | int     (*con_resize)(struct vc_data *, unsigned int, unsigned int, | 
|  | unsigned int); | 
|  | int	(*con_set_palette)(struct vc_data *, unsigned char *); | 
|  | int	(*con_scrolldelta)(struct vc_data *, int); | 
|  | int	(*con_set_origin)(struct vc_data *); | 
|  | void	(*con_save_screen)(struct vc_data *); | 
|  | u8	(*con_build_attr)(struct vc_data *, u8, u8, u8, u8, u8, u8); | 
|  | void	(*con_invert_region)(struct vc_data *, u16 *, int); | 
|  | u16    *(*con_screen_pos)(struct vc_data *, int); | 
|  | unsigned long (*con_getxy)(struct vc_data *, unsigned long, int *, int *); | 
|  | /* | 
|  | * Prepare the console for the debugger.  This includes, but is not | 
|  | * limited to, unblanking the console, loading an appropriate | 
|  | * palette, and allowing debugger generated output. | 
|  | */ | 
|  | int	(*con_debug_enter)(struct vc_data *); | 
|  | /* | 
|  | * Restore the console to its pre-debug state as closely as possible. | 
|  | */ | 
|  | int	(*con_debug_leave)(struct vc_data *); | 
|  | }; |

|  | /* | 
|  | * The interface for a console, or any other device that wants to capture | 
|  | * console messages (printer driver?) | 
|  | * | 
|  | * If a console driver is marked CON_BOOT then it will be auto-unregistered | 
|  | * when the first real console is registered.  This is for early-printk drivers. | 
|  | */ | 
|  |  | 
|  | #define CON_PRINTBUFFER	(1) | 
|  | #define CON_CONSDEV	(2) /* Last on the command line */ | 
|  | #define CON_ENABLED	(4) | 
|  | #define CON_BOOT	(8) | 
|  | #define CON_ANYTIME	(16) /* Safe to call when cpu is offline */ | 
|  | #define CON_BRL		(32) /* Used for a braille device */ | 
|  |  | 
|  | struct console { | 
|  | char	name[16]; | 
|  | void	(*write)(struct console *, const char *, unsigned); | 
|  | int	(*read)(struct console *, char *, unsigned); | 
|  | struct tty_driver *(*device)(struct console *, int *); | 
|  | void	(*unblank)(void); | 
|  | int	(*setup)(struct console *, char *); | 
|  | int	(*early_setup)(void); | 
|  | short	flags; | 
|  | short	index; | 
|  | int	cflag; | 
|  | void	*data; | 
|  | struct	 console *next; | 
|  | }; | 
|  |  | 
|  | /* | 
|  | * for_each_console() allows you to iterate on each console | 
|  | */ | 
|  | #define for_each_console(con) \ | 
|  | for (con = console_drivers; con != NULL; con = con->next) |
